How Will Policy and Investments Shape the Future of India’s Solar Sector?

Solar Sector Updates: Key Developments and Investments

About the Solar Industry

The Indian solar sector is expanding rapidly, driven by government incentives, private investments, and growing energy demand. Companies are scaling up production, enhancing technology, and entering strategic partnerships to meet the nation’s renewable energy targets.

Policy and Finance Initiatives

The Ministry of New and Renewable Energy (MNRE) is considering measures to provide renewable power firms with better access to bank loans. This step is expected to ease financing for solar projects, boosting capacity addition and sector growth.

Corporate Updates

  • Vikram Solar has secured a 336MW module supply order from L&T, reinforcing its position as a leading solar module manufacturer.
  • Gautam Solar plans to invest ₹4,000cr in a new solar cell manufacturing facility in Madhya Pradesh, aiming to expand domestic production capacity and reduce import dependence.
